Artwork history & notes

Provenance

unidentified collector (Lugt 365); William Esdaile [1758-1837], Clapham Common, London (Lugt 2617); Siegfried Barden [1854-1917], Hamburg (Lugt 218); purchased 1929 at Print Club of Philadelphia by Lessing J. Rosenwald [1891-1979], Jenkintown, PA; gift to NGA, 1953.
